Chemistry
CAS: 30007-47-7
Molecular Formula: C4H6BrNO4
Molecular Weight: 212
IUPAC Name: 5-bromo-5-nitro-1,3-dioxane
Molecular structure:

EINECS: 250-001-7
H bond acceptors: 5
H bond donors: 0
Freely Rotating Bonds: 1
Polar Surface Area: 64.28 Å2
Melting point: 60°C
Storage temp: Refrigerator
Index of Refraction: 1.532
Molar Refractivity: 35.77 cm3
Molar Volume: 115.3 cm3
Polarizability: 14.18 10-24cm3
Surface Tension: 51.6 dyne/cm
Density: 1.83 g/cm3
Flash Point: 123.6 °C
Enthalpy of Vaporization: 51.95 kJ/mol
Boiling Point: 280.8 °C at 760 mmHg
Vapour Pressure: 0.00371 mmHg at 25°C
InChI
InChI=1/C4H6BrNO4/c5-4(6(7)8)1-9-3-10-2-4/h1-3H2
Smiles
C1([N+](=O)[O-])(COCOC1)Br

Uses
5-Bromo-5-nitro-1,3-dioxane (CAS NO.30007-47-7) is commonly used for the preparation of cosmetics, paints, etc.
Toxicity Data With Reference
| Organism | Test Type | Route | Reported Dose (Normalized Dose) | Effect | Source |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| mouse | LD50 | oral | 590mg/kg (590m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: TREMOR BEHAVIORAL: CONVULSIONS OR EFFECT ON SEIZURE THRESHOLD BEHAVIORAL: EXCITEMENT | Fette, Seifen, Anstrichmittel. Vol. 78, Pg. 269, 1976. |
| rabbit | LDLo | subcutaneous | 500mg/kg (500m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: CONVULSIONS OR EFFECT ON SEIZURE THRESHOLD BEHAVIORAL: EXCITEMENT SKIN AND APPENDAGES (SKIN): "DERMATITIS, OTHER: AFTER SYSTEMIC EXPOSURE" | Fette, Seifen, Anstrichmittel. Vol. 78, Pg. 269, 1976. |
| rat | LD50 | intraperitoneal | 31mg/kg (31m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: TREMOR BEHAVIORAL: CONVULSIONS OR EFFECT ON SEIZURE THRESHOLD BEHAVIORAL: EXCITEMENT | Fette, Seifen, Anstrichmittel. Vol. 78, Pg. 269, 1976. |
| rat | LD50 | oral | 455mg/kg (455mg/kg) | BEHAVIORAL: TREMOR BEHAVIORAL: CONVULSIONS OR EFFECT ON SEIZURE THRESHOLD BEHAVIORAL: EXCITEMENT | Fette, Seifen, Anstrichmittel. Vol. 78, Pg. 269, 1976. |
Consensus Reports
Reported in EPA TSCA Inventory.
Safety Profile
Poison by intraperitoneal route. Moderately toxic by ingestion and subcutaneous routes. A skin irritant. When heated to decomposition it emits very toxic fumes of Br− and NOx.
Hazard Codes:
Xn
Risk Statements: 22-38
R22:Harmful if swallowed.
R38:Irritating to skin.
Safety Statements: 36
S36:Wear suitable protective clothing.
RIDADR: 1759
WGK Germany: 3
Specification
5-Bromo-5-nitro-1,3-dioxane (CAS NO.30007-47-7) can be also called as Bronidox; Bronidox l ; 3-Dioxane,5-bromo-5-nitro-1 ; 5-Brom-5-nitro-1,3-dioxan ; 5-bromo-5-nitro-3-dioxane ; 5-Bromo-5-Nitro-1,3-Dioxame and so on. 5-Bromo-5-nitro-1,3-dioxane (CAS NO.30007-47-7) is commonly in the form of white crystal powder.
